Why is Venice overrated?

The name Venice inspires romantic images of gondola rides down gorgeous canals as grand historic architecture goes by. But, Venice is quickly becoming an overrated vacation spot. Too many people are trying to spend holidays in this amazing city, causing it to become overcrowded.

Is Rome overrated as a vacation destination?

Although Rome is an incredible vacation destination for many people, this leads to a problem as well. The city has become overrated as a vacation destination for some. With the huge tourist crowds that descend on the city every day, it becomes horribly crowded and hard to move around.
